#include<bits/stdc++.h>

using namespace std;

//=====================================================================================================================================

#define ll long long
#define ld long double
#define fi first
#define se second
#define pb push_back
#define pll pair<ll, ll>
#define pli pair<ll, int>
#define pil pair<int, ll>
#define pii pair<int, int>
#define BIT(i, mask) ((mask >> (i)) & 1)
#define DAOBIT(i, mask) ((mask ^ (1 << i)))
#define OFFBIT(i, mask) ((mask & ~(1 << (i))))
#define ONBIT(i, mask) ((mask | (1 << (i))))
#define nmax 1000007

//=====================================================================================================================================

const int N = 1e6 + 7;
const ll mod = 1e9 + 6;
const ll MOD = 1e9 + 7;
const ll inf = 1e18;

bool check_sub2 = 1;

int n, q;
vector<pil> adj[N];
int ts[10];
int u, v;
ll w;
ll sum_w;
//=====================================================================================================================================

void fre(){
    freopen("TET.INP", "r", stdin);
    freopen("TET.out", "w", stdout);
}
ll gcd(ll a, ll b){
    return b ? gcd(b, a % b) : a;
}

ll lcm(ll a, ll b){
    return (a / gcd(a, b)) * b;
}

namespace sub2{
    ll d[N];
    void pre_sub2(int u, int p, ll w){
        d[u] = w;
        for(pil e : adj[u]){
            int v = e.fi;
            ll w2 = e.se;
            if(v == p) continue;
            pre_sub2(v, u, w + w2);
        }
    }
    void solve(){
        int root = 0;
        for(int i = 1; i <= n; i++) if(adj[i].size() == 1) root = i;
        pre_sub2(root, 0, 0);
        while(q--){
            for(int i = 1; i <= 5; i++) cin >> ts[i];
            for(int i = 1; i <= 5; i++) ts[i]++;
            ll ans = 0;
            for(int i = 1; i <= 5; i++){
                for(int j = 1; j <= 5; j++){
                    ans = max(ans, d[ts[j]] - d[ts[i]]);
//                    cout << ts[j] << ' ' << ts[i] << ' ' << d[ts[j]] - d[ts[i]] << '\n';
                }
            }
            cout << ans << '\n';
        }
    }
}

namespace sub3{
    int cnt[N];
    ll wtp[N];
    bool f[N];
    void dfs_sub3(int u, int p){
        if(f[u]) cnt[u]++;
        for(pil e : adj[u]){
            int v = e.fi;
            ll w2 = e.se;
            if(v == p) continue;
            dfs_sub3(v, u);
            wtp[v] = w2;
            cnt[u] += cnt[v];
        }
    }
    void solve(){
        while(q--){
            for(int i = 1; i <= 5; i++) cin >> ts[i];
            for(int i = 1; i <= 5; i++) ts[i]++;
            for(int i = 1; i <= 5; i++) f[ts[i]] = 1;
            ll ans = sum_w;
            dfs_sub3(1, 0);
            for(int i = 1; i <= n; i++){
                if(cnt[i] == 0 || cnt[i] == 5) ans -= wtp[i];
                cnt[i] = 0;
            }
            for(int i = 1; i <= 5; i++) f[ts[i]] = 0;
            cout << ans << '\n';
        }
    }
}


//=====================================================================================================================================

int main(){
    cin.tie(0)->sync_with_stdio(0);
    // fre();
    cin >> n;
    for(int i = 1; i < n; i++){
        cin >> u >> v >> w;
        u++;
        v++;
        adj[u].pb({v, w});
        adj[v].pb({u, w});
        sum_w += w;
        check_sub2 &= (adj[u].size() <= 2);
        check_sub2 &= (adj[v].size() <= 2);
    }
    if(n == 5 && q == 1){
        cout << sum_w << '\n';
        return 0;
    }
    cin >> q;
    if(check_sub2){
        sub2 :: solve();
        return 0;
    }
    if(n <= 50000 && q <= 100){
        sub3 :: solve();
        return 0;
    }




    return 0;
}
